MMCA
What does MMCA mean in Regional?
This page explains the full form, abbreviation, and meaning of MMCA in the Regional category.
MMCA stands for:
Cananea
MMCA is an abbreviation that can have different meanings depending on the context in which it is used.
Explore more: Regional category
Other meanings of MMCA
| Term | Meaning |
|---|---|
| MMCA |
Midbody Motor Control Assembly. |